Medical Expertise of Dr. Daniel Katz, MD

Dr. Katz specializes in child neurology - diagnosing, treating and managing neurological disorders of children, including epilepsy and headaches and performing EMGs tests to evaluate neuromuscular conditions.

About Dr. Daniel Katz, MD

Daniel Katz, MD is a board-certified neurologist providing care to patients in Topeka Kansas.
